About A. Yoshii
A. Yoshii is a scholar working on Atomic and Molecular Physics, and Optics, Electrical and Electronic Engineering, Toxicology, Nephrology and Electrochemistry, having authored 43 papers that have together received 563 indexed citations. Recurring topics across this work include Advancements in Semiconductor Devices and Circuit Design (28 papers), Semiconductor materials and devices (16 papers), Semiconductor Quantum Structures and Devices (11 papers), Silicon and Solar Cell Technologies (10 papers), Silicon Carbide Semiconductor Technologies (10 papers), Quantum and electron transport phenomena (9 papers), Semiconductor materials and interfaces (5 papers) and Integrated Circuits and Semiconductor Failure Analysis (3 papers). The work is most often cited by research in Electrical and Electronic Engineering (461 citations), Atomic and Molecular Physics, and Optics (196 citations), Automotive Engineering (36 citations), Biomaterials (23 citations) and Surfaces, Coatings and Films (11 citations). A. Yoshii has collaborated with scholars based in Japan and United States. Frequent co-authors include M. Tomizawa, K. Yokoyama, T. Sudo, S. Horiguchi, Nobuyuki Sano, Shinji Sakai, Kenji Horii, Hideaki Taniyama, T. Aoki and T. Adachi. Their work appears in journals such as IEEE Transactions on Electron Devices, IEEE Electron Device Letters, Journal of Applied Physics, Semiconductor Science and Technology and European Heart Journal.
